Output 8c69f902845b33f0a0d5f9c920e929f2a91d35ecabcb98a3c7fc71bbc8193aef: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ae390c14a49b54d59ba2d0c0c72efda508147344 OP_EQUAL
address
3HaDqdXEv57EWg7RPn5H7jz4j7xn8P2Gj7
transaction
8c69f902845b33f0a0d5f9c920e929f2a91d35ecabcb98a3c7fc71bbc8193aef
spent
true